The article tells about the life and main directions of scientific research of the outstanding Soviet and Russian scientist in the field of mechanics, Academician Gorimir Gorimirovich Cherny (1923–2012); as well as it gives an overview of some of the results obtained to date in the development of his work in the field of analytical study of the dynamics of shock waves in inhomogeneous media, determining the optimal shape of bodies in a supersonic flow, exothermic flows, boundary layer theory, transonic flows. A graduate of Moscow University, G.G. Cherny was a participant in the Great Patriotic War, after its end he played a big role in the development of many areas of science, the organization of scientific research, the education of scientific personnel. He was one of the founders of the Research Institute of Mechanics at Moscow State University, held managerial positions in scientific and educational institutions, and created a scientific school in the field of mechanics. Research by G.G. Cherny, in the main, referred to high-speed gas dynamics. He carried out analytical studies of the subtle issues of calculating flows in various conditions and devices. Many of his results have become classic.

After the Second World War, many Ukrainian intellectuals were forced to leave their native land, but they still remained as true patriots of their land and had carried out Ukrainian research studies. The article is devoted to the activity of famous Ukrainian researcher who lived in the USA – Petro Oryshkevych (1909–1982) – a doctor of geography, a teacher, a public figure, director of the Taras Shevchenko School of Ukrainian Studies of Greater Washington, a correspondent member and secretary of the Branch of the Shevchenko Scientific Society in Washington. The main achievements of the scientist in publishing activities were illuminated. The article describes Peter Oryshkevych as a teacher in many educational institutions of different countries: gymnasiums, seminary, trade and high schools in Peremyshl, Lviv, Zolochiv, Dillingen (Germany), Washington (USA). The contribution of Petro Oryshkevych in the creation (in 1957) and development of the Branch of the Scientific Society of Taras Shevchenko in Washington, where he was a Corresponding Member and Secretary of the Branch, is highlighted. The role of Petro Oryshkevych in the development of the Taras Shevchenko School of Ukrainian Studies of Greater Washington is described. The description of the most important researcher’s works, which concern the learning of geography of Ukraine, and his scientific activity in emigration in the USA were given. In particular, the main works of the scientist were considered. Among them are Ukrainians of Zasyannya (1962), Introductory Geography of Ukraine and Ukrainian Settlements (1974), Geography of Ukrainians (Rusyny) of Great Washington (1981). Petro Oryshkevych had left a remarkable trace in Ukrainian geography. His scientific research is widely known both among Ukrainians abroad and in Ukraine. The merit of István Udvari is enormous in the field of investigation of Ukrainian language history, the Ukrainian and Rusyn historical dialectology, the language of the Bachka-Srem Rusyns, the Ukrainian and Ruthenian Studies in Hungary, the Ukrainian-Hungarian and the Rusyn-Hungarian interlingual contacts, the identification, study and publication of the ancient Eastern and South Slavic written monuments; it was he who brought back to the science the forgotten linguists, historians, and other cultural figures. A significant contribution to the «rehabilitation» of the scientific activity of the scientist Antony (Antal) Hodinka belongs to Professor Udvari. A. Hodinka (1864–1946) is a famous historian, philologist, folklorist, publicist, and educator. He made a significant contribution to the development of Transcarpathia and Hungary's history and culture, particularly the history of the Greek Catholic Church, Hungarian-Slavic and Hungarian-Eastern Slavic historical and interlingual contacts. With the accession of Transcarpathia to the Soviet Union, with the ban on the functioning of the Greek Catholic Church, the activity of A. Hodinka was forgotten for many decades. The article aims to investigate and properly evaluate the scientific heritage of A. Hodinka through István Udvari's scientific research. The article is devoted to the review of scientific activity and works of the doctor of philological sciences, professor Z.K. Temirgazina and is dedicated to her 60th anniversary. She deals with theoretical problems of linguistic axiology and pragmatic linguistics, which her monographs and articles are devoted to including the international collective monographs Linguistic Axiology, Pragmalinguistics, and Gender Linguistics published under her editorship. In the last decade, pedagogical and political discourses as well as applied aspects of linguistics, in particular, the problems of multilingual education in Kazakhstani schools and their educational and methodological support have become the subject of her scientific research.
